How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Eastside?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Eastside Studio Apartments | $910 | $790 | $1,250 |
Eastside 1 Bedroom Apartments | $972 | $380 | $1,904 |
Eastside 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,106 | $700 | $1,610 |
Eastside 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,485 | $1,000 | $1,700 |
Eastside 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,920 | $1,920 | $1,920 |
